The public sector is the part of economic life‚ not in private ownership‚ that deals with the production‚ delivery‚ and allocation of basic public goods and services at global‚1 regional‚ national‚2 or local levels. (Its processes and structures can take the form of direct administration‚ public corporations‚ and partial outsourcing.
